Lyretail coralfish -
Zászlós tündérsügér (15 cm)
Orange with yellow-centered scales; males with elongate dorsal filament and red patch on P fin. Occurs in aggregations near coral outcrops of clear lagoons, patch reefs and steep slopes, 0,3 to 35 m. Abundant, sometimes in enormous swarms above the reef. Male is territorial and maintains a harem of 5 to 10 females.
Range: Red Sea to Fiji, north to S. Japan, south to S. Africa; absent from Oman and Arabian Gulf.
